Podrobnosti Software:
fassembler je build systém pro OpenCore.
To by mohlo být pro všeobecné použití build software la GNU Zkontrolujte, Buildit, et al. Ale je to vyvinuta speciálně pro sestavení a nasazení potřeby softwaru, který běží CoActivate.org.
Jak používat Fassembler
Viz http://www.coactivate.org/projects/fassembler/howto
What je nový v této verzi:
- Změny Fassembler:
- Přidán nový tasks.InstallSpecIfPresent, který zkontroluje, zda cesta k požadavkům specifikace je k dispozici na souborovém systému, a nedělá nic, pokud soubor neexistuje.
- tasks.VirtualEnv (never_create_virtualenv = True) již běží nějaké dílčích úkolů.
- Přidán nový úkol fassembler.apache.CheckApache, která bude kontrolovat přítomnost seznam požadovaných modulů Apache. Musí být volána z projektu, který podtřídy fassembler.apache.ApacheMixin.
- změny projektu:
- fassembler: topp nyní instaluje požadavky / fassembler-req.txt do fassembler VIRTUALENV, je-li tento soubor přítomen. Tento soubor můžete zadat add-on balíčky, které poskytují další fassembler projektů, které mají být použity ve zbytku sestavení.
- Tato akce byla již dříve provádí obnově-opencore-stránky skript v opencore-fassembler_boot a je zde přesunuty na lepší zapouzdření staví. (Build by měl být schopen spustit pouze z fassembler,. Opencore-fassembler_boot by mělo být jen balíček pohodlí, která obaluje fassembler more hlubší znalost)
- Různé změny konfigurace v fassembler:. Buildmaster a buildslave
- fassembler: wordpress nyní kontroluje přítomnost svých požadovaných modulů Apache, včetně modulu Apache PHP .
- Pečeme v připnul požadavky na i18ndude sub-projektu opencore je.
Co je nového ve verzi 0.5:
- Přidat `` num_extra_zopes`` objektů životního objektu, který hledá `` prostředí num_extra_zopes`` v [obecné] části build.ini a vrátí jako celé číslo, nebo 0, pokud takové nastavení neexistuje.
- Toto nastavení pak bude použit k vyplnění v hodnotě `` opencore_remote_uri`` v konfiguraci frontendu, což umožňuje rozhraní pro proxy s vyrovnáváním zatížení sadu instancí Zope.
- `` nastavení num_extra_zopes`` byla také přidána do fassembler:. Projektu TOPP, kde je uložen na build.ini
Požadavky na :
- Python
Komentáře nebyl nalezen